WebApr 11, 2024 · April 11, 2024. If you can't file your federal tax return by the April 18, 2024, deadline, request an extension. An extension gives you until October 16, 2024, to file your 2024 federal income tax return. You can use IRS Free File at IRS.gov/freefile to request an automatic filing extension or file Form 4868, Application for Automatic Extension ... Types of Free Federal … WebGovernment grant scammers might start by asking for personal information, like your Social Security number, to see if you “qualify” for the grant (you will). Then they’ll ask for your bank account information — maybe to deposit “grant money” into your account or to pay up-front fees. Or they’ll ask you to pay those fees with a ... roller coasters louisiana
